What Can You Do About Sexual Dysfunction?

Your personal sexual dysfunction can be an awkward discussion to have, but it’s fairly common with men and women of all ages — and more so for those getting older. According to recent studies, sexual dysfunction affects up to 69% of men and 41% of women worldwide.

Fortunately, there are ways to treat sexual dysfunction without resorting to buying the pills you see being advertised on television. In addition to the steps you can take to improve your overall health, treatments are available to restore your sexual function.

Sexual dysfunction in men

Sexual dysfunction in men can be caused by a variety of reasons. The biggest natural cause is age, especially in the case of erectile dysfunction or impotence. Lifestyle choices can also lower your libido and cause sexual dysfunction. These may include:

Men with healthy lifestyles and no chronic diseases have the lowest risk for erectile dysfunction.
